TYPE APPROVAL DOCUMENTS EXPLANATIONS WVTA Technical Book DECEMBER 2010

INTRODUCTION Le Technical Book est un document européen Les explications suivantes ainsi que les extraits sont en anglais PAGE 2

INFORMATION DOCUMENT TECHNICAL BOOK PAGE 3

KEY INFORMATION An information document Covers one Type Identifies the diversity covered in the type Lists the technical characteristics applicable to the vehicles belonging to the type States that all vehicles belonging to the type fulfill the type approval regulation according to Annex IV Only covers the diversity which is allowed by the separate approvals Gives the allowed TVV In the Midlum R 4x2 information document Possible according to the Matrix 55 987 200 Allowed 42 072 What is physically built shall be fully consistent with the information document (can be checked during a vehicle inspection) Is the synthesis of all the limits defined in the ECE certificates, without, as much as possible, technical limits and commercial limits. Chapter 2 : Masses and dimensions (in kg and mm) The information document provides information About : DIMENSIONS Wheelbase & axle spacing Track of all axles For chassis without bodywork (incomplete) Length & maximum & minimum permissible length Width & maximum & minimum permissible width height For chassis with bodywork (complete or completed) Length & length of the loading area Width Thickness of the wall height PAGE 11

Chapter 2 : Masses and dimensions (in kg and mm) DIMENSIONS PAGE 12

Chapter 2 : Masses and dimensions (in kg and mm) Distinction between : Technical masses MASSES Technical masses mean the maximum masses of the vehicle based on its construction and performance, and as stated by the manufacturer. Registration masses Registration masses mean the maximum masses of vehicle at which the vehicle itself can be registered or put into service in a Member State at the request of the vehicle manufacturer. (The information is optional, but if these values are given, they shall be verified in accordance with the requirements of Annex IV of 97/27/EC) PAGE 13

Chapter 2 : Masses and dimensions (in kg and mm) As a summary : MASSES The technically permissible mass on the front axle (identified as a version) + The technically permissible mass on the rear axle (identified as a version) Identified in 2.9 Give a unique TPMLM (2.8) Give a unique registration mass in one country (2.16.1) PAGE 14

Chapter 4 : Transmission The information document provides information about: The type of transmission (mechanical, hydraulic, electric, ) The type of gearbox (manual, automatic, continuously variable transmission The gear ratios Internal Final drive ratios Total gear ratios The maximum speed Presence of a tachograph and its approval mark PAGE 17

Chapter 4 : Transmission PAGE 18

Chapter 5 : Axles The information document provides : The description of each axle Their make Their type The position of retractable axle The position of loadable axle PAGE 19

Chapter 6 : Suspensions The information document provides : The type of the suspension of each axle The presence or not of a level adjustment Air suspension for driving axle or non driving axle Equivalent suspension for driving axle or non driving axle PAGE 20

Chapter 6 : Tyre / wheel combinations The information document provides : The tyre / wheel combinations allowed for each axle Including size designation, load capacity index, speed category symbol, rolling resistance for tyres Including rim size and offset for wheels Upper and lower limits of rolling radii for each axle PAGE 21

Chapter 7 : Steering The information document provides : General information about the steering transmission and control PAGE 22

Chapter 8 : Brakes The information document provides : the braking system, providing a brief description of the service braking system, the secondary braking system and the parking braking system It also lists the diversity of engine brakes, gearboxes and retarders covered It gives allowed drivelines, so the one fulfilling the endurance braking performance for N3 +O4 and for ADR vehicles above 16t or allowed to tow O4 PAGE 23

Chapter 8 : Brakes Annex I: Additional Restrictions due to endurance braking performance This Annex lists additional restrictions compared to those already given in the information document To see if a driveline is allowed, check first what is allowed in tables 6.6.1 : tyres allowed according to TVV 6.6.2 : rolling radius authorized by TVV 4.6 : authorized drive ratio by TVV Then check according to Annex I PAGE 24

Chapter 9 : Bodywork The information document provides information about The type of European bodywork, for complete or completed vehicles only For Tractor for semitrailor when the fifth wheel is present (Rule : 5 kw/t) For Road tractor «Tireur» (Rule : 2,2 kw/t) Investigation to code it in the TVV PAGE 25

Chapter 9 : Bodywork For completed vehicles only : The ID gives the number and configuration of doors The ID gives the rear view mirror make, approval number, The ID gives the number of seating position, their location, arrangement The ID gives the drawing of the manufacturer s plate and its location The ID provides the meaning of the characters of the VIN numbers The ID identifies for which TVVs the FUP is fitted PAGE 26

Chapter 11 : Connections between Towing Vehicles & Trailers and Semi-trailers The information document provides The class and type of the coupling device(s) fitted or to be fitted Chapter 12 : Miscellaneous The information document just gives the information if the vehicle is equipped or not with a 24 GHz short-range radar equipment Chapter 13 : Only applicable to buses and coaches Chapter 16 : Access to vehicle repair and maintenance information PAGE 27
